Unresolved Challenges and Areas of Ongoing Development
While many AI tools and hardware devices are now available, full integration with existing legacy systems remains a challenge for some organizations. Details about the long-term security, data privacy implications, and standardization of new automation protocols are still emerging. Additionally, the pace of regulatory developments and their impact on AI deployment in workplaces are uncertain, with ongoing debates about ethical use and accountability.

Key Questions
What are the most important AI tools to watch in 2026?
Key tools include scalable AI software frameworks, automation hardware devices with modular designs, and integrated data storage solutions that support real-time processing and security.
How are these AI developments affecting small and medium-sized businesses?
Many of the new AI platforms and hardware are now more accessible and affordable, enabling smaller companies to automate workflows, analyze data more effectively, and compete with larger organizations.
What are the main challenges in adopting these new AI tools?
Organizations face issues related to system compatibility, data privacy, security concerns, and the need for workforce training to effectively utilize new technologies.
Will AI replace human jobs in 2026?
While AI automation is increasing efficiency and reducing some manual tasks, experts emphasize that it is more likely to augment human roles rather than fully replace them, with new jobs and skills emerging as a result.
What regulations are expected to influence AI deployment in workplaces?
Regulatory frameworks around data privacy, security standards, and ethical use are expected to evolve, with policymakers aiming to balance innovation with safeguards for workers and consumers.
